Editorial Review

From the packagers of Sushi Samba and Steak Frites comes kitschy Americana "diner." Always bustling on quiet side street. Shabby chic crashpad with wobbly tables and worn booths. Atrium girls order cosmos with mac 'n' cheese, hold the bacon. Comfort food far from authentic, you won't recognize that fried chicken from your secret trailer park childhood below the Mason-Dixon. Good fries and butterlicious mashed potatoes, however. If the waitress wore roller skates, that would be fun.
